
Cyril Gamini
Cyril Gamini is a prominent figure within the Catholic Church in Sri Lanka, currently serving as the National Catholic Communication Director. He has been vocal about the Church's stance against the death penalty, emphasizing the importance of mercy and justice in the legal system. Recently, he addressed concerns regarding statements made by others in the Church about potential death penalties in relation to serious crimes, reaffirming that the Catholic Church does not advocate for capital punishment regardless of the circumstances. His comments come in the context of ongoing discussions about accountability and justice following past violent incidents in the country.
